    My younger brother has an 07 astra car/van that he bought from new, his never had a problem with it untl Friday when he put the key in the ignition and it wouldnt turn, steering lock was jammed, we spent a long time jerking the steering wheel and trying to turn the key but no way would the key turn.
    He rang opel dealer who sold him the car and spoke to a mechanic who said "ah yes that happens in the hot weather, a part expands in the heat and jams the lock" Well ive never heard anything like that before, he also said a new barrel was needed and it would take 2 weeks to get one, get the car on a truck and bring it in to us.
    We took the ignition barrel off and brought it to a local locksmith who on inspection told us the pins in the barrel had collapsed and there is no other problem with it, nothing that the hot weather could of caused.
    Long and short of it is it will be fixed tomorrow at a cost of 100e.
    I would like to know if anyone here has had a similar problem with an opel?
    Dread to think what the bill would be if we left the car into the dealer to fix.
